In 2009, Jack Dorsey formed a company to provide a credit card payment system via iPhones. What is the name of that company?

Explanation:
This question tests your knowledge of the company Jack Dorsey formed to enable credit card payments on iPhones. He co-founded Square in 2009 with Jim McKelvey to let people and small businesses accept card payments through a small card reader that plugs into an iPhone, paired with an app that processes the transaction. This mobile hardware plus software approach is what makes Square the right answer. Stripe is known for online payments and APIs, Clover is a POS system from a large processor not started by Dorsey, and PayPal is an established payments company founded earlier with a different focus. Square is the one that matches the scenario.
